12 October in Australian History

Here are some of the events that happened on this day in Australian history. Please feel free to add others that you know of in the comments section.

  • 1846 – Bushranger Lawrence Kavenagh is executed by hanging.
  • 1912 – A fire at Mount Lyell traps miners underground, killing 42 men.
  • 1923 – Cairns, Queensland is proclaimed a city.
  • 1982 – The National Gallery of Australia is opened in Canberra.
  • 1985 – Canon Arthur Marshall became the first Aboriginal bishop in Australia.
  • 1988 – Two police officers are killed in the Walsh Street police shootings.
  • 2002 – Eighty-eight Australians are killed in Bali in bombings committed by Jemaah Islamiyah (pictured: The Sari Club after the bombings) (read the full story here).
  • 2003 – Death of Jim Cairns, Deputy Prime Minister in the Whitlam government, aged 89.
  • 2004 – Simon Crean resigns from the position of Shadow Treasurer, and John Faulkner resigns as Leader of the Opposition in the Senate in the aftermath of the Australian Labor Party’s election loss.
